Hey everyone.
I wanted to share that over the past month my computer has been freezing while playing a game, and I often leave YouTube or social media open on another monitor. Usually both screens freeze, but I can still hear the video playing, which is strange. If it’s going to crash, why not just freeze everything? It’s becoming really bothersome now—it usually happens once a day. I think I posted this question a few weeks ago and people were curious about temperature changes during freezing. I’m not sure what’s causing it, but it’s starting to annoy me a lot. I’d really appreciate any advice or tips to fix this.
